Your tracks should match the general tastefulness of the room. Nosing comes in various shapes, and everyone gives an alternate shift focus over to your completed steps. The following are a couple of the shapes you can browse:

Pencil Shape Rounded Nosing: There is a round nose, which has the sweep of a pencil, which gives it its name. It's anything but a major bend, however, it looks great

Squared Shape Nosing: Although it has a level edge, the corner is somewhat adjusted. The levelness of the edge gives it the name "squared" nosing. It looks exquisite, and the bent corners make it generally protected.

Half-Bull Nosing: One corner of the edge has a major bend. The other corner is level.

Full Bull Nosing: Unlike the half bull nose, this style offers a total bend that incorporates the two corners, consequently making it a full bull nose.

No Overhand Nosing: As its name proposes, it sits flush with the step riser Unlike other Decking Tiles, it doesn't hang in front of the step riser, however, it's intended to diminish slips and falls by as yet keeping the nosing apparent.
